Ticket: Staging env misconfigured for Siftgate bloom filter

The bloom layer in front of the Pellet KV store is rejecting all lookups in staging because the env file was copied from the dev template without credentials. False-positive tuning values are fine; only the auth line is missing. To unblock the weekly demo, the Pellet admission secret must be set on the following line.

env line for yaguf-fajop: LEDGER_TOKEN13=fb08984397349

/*
 * FORMULA_SANDBOX_TIMEOUT_MS — hard cap for user-supplied formulas
 * in Gridlet sheets. Support: if customers report "formula aborted,"
 * their expression hit this limit. Do not raise per-tenant; the
 * sandbox also blocks I/O and recursion past depth 40. Escalate
 * instead. Verified against the build noted below.
 */

pipeline stamp: htk6_35e0c9

**Mgmt Meeting Minutes — Retiring the Brightline Range**

Quick recap for sales leads at Fenholt Supplies: we agreed to retire the Brightline fixture range by year-end. Remaining stock moves to clearance pricing next month, and accounts on standing orders get migrated to the Lumetta range. Trade-in incentives were approved in principle. The confidential note on next steps sits just below.

board note of bajof-bajeg: The pricing group signed off on a budget of $13.4 million for Project Sildor. The renewal with Lamixek Holdings closes at $48.9 million a year, 49 percent above the last contract.